About These Birds

Ringed Storm-petrel

Ringed Storm-petrel, 21–23 cm, is an extremely poorly known species with a highly restricted range over the Humboldt Current off Peru and Chile. White underparts with a distinctive dark breast band — giving the 'ringed' appearance. Breeding grounds unknown until recently; likely nests in Atacama Desert.

Least Storm-petrel

World's smallest seabird at 13–15 cm. Sooty-black with white rump; short rounded wings. Breeds Baja California islands; ranges offshore in eastern Pacific to Ecuador. Feeds on zooplankton and small fish by pattering on the surface. Nocturnal at breeding colonies; Near Threatened.
